On his post-college career…
I’ve been blessed to work with some of the best coaches in the country. I coached at the University of Florida with the likes of Steve Spurrier and Bev Kearney, the University of Texas, where Jody Conrad was my athletic director and Texas Tech University with Marsha Sharpe and Spike Dykes. Not only did we have some amazing success with some of the teams winning SEC championships and Big 12 championships, but I also got to experience some amazing mentoring from the coaches along the way.
On AP Ranch…
In 2012, we started Athletic Performance Ranch (AP Ranch), a youth track club in Fort Worth, Texas, for kids aged 9 to 18. Our goal is to use athletics as kind of a means to an end. We teach work ethic, humility, how to live with success and failure and the habits that it takes to be successful through education and sports.
Our mission is to provide a facility and access to the kids who didn't have it. There are tons of schools in Texas that have amazing budgets, but there are a lot of schools that don't have the budgets and the additional support. So we try to work with those schools and be the community they need to have success.
Some of the kids have gone on to compete at the Olympic level and have professional careers, but the ones we're really excited about are the kids that learn how to overcome obstacles and be teammates.
